Bayt El-Maarifa played a leading role in the successful completion of the 2025 regional initiative on the nexus between corruption and the water sector in the Arab States region, implemented by the United Nations Development Programme (UNDP) through its Regional Project on Anti-Corruption and Integrity in Arab Countries (ACIAC). The director of Bayt El-Maarifa served as the international consultant for the project, providing technical expertise and strategic guidance throughout its implementation. The initiative strengthened transparency, accountability, and integrity mechanisms in water governance across participating countries by bringing together government institutions, anti-corruption authorities, water ministries, civil society organisations, and regional experts to develop evidence-based policies and enhance institutional capacities. The project also fostered regional dialogue on sustainable water governance in response to growing climate pressures and water scarcity challenges across the Arab region, marking an important milestone in advancing good governance and sustainable development.
